Commission
A fee or percentage awarded to an individual or group for performing a service or facilitating a transaction.
Required Deduction
A mandatory subtraction from gross income, such as taxes or social security contributions, which lowers taxable income.
Unemployment Tax
A tax imposed by governments on employers based on the wages paid to employees, used to fund unemployment compensation programs.
FICA Tax
A federal tax in the United States, consisting of a Social Security tax and a Medicare tax, deducted from employees' paychecks to fund these programs.
